St. Mary Mead. St. Mary Mead is the fictional village where Jane Marple lives. Through the years and novels, the town is shown to have dramatic growth and change. The town is about 25 miles south of London and about 12 miles from the coast. As seen on the map, the town is just 2 miles west of Much Benham.

Miss Jane Marple is a fictional character in Agatha Christie's crime novels and short stories. Miss Marple lives in the village of St. Mary Mead and acts as an amateur consulting detective.Often characterized as an elderly spinster, she is one of Christie's best-known characters and has been portrayed numerous times on screen. The fictional village of St Mary Mead is about 25 miles from London and 12 miles from the coast. The main train station is in "Much Benham" two miles away. Although Murder at the Vicarage (1930) is the first novel set in St Mary Mead, the village itself was mentioned several times in her Poirot novel, The Mystery of the Blue Train (1928).
